Exploring antifungal potential: the flavonoid composition of Machaerium villosum extracts against Cryptococcus neoformans.
The objective of this study was, therefore, to conduct a chemical analysis and assess the biological potential of the hydroethanolic extract obtained from the leaves of Machaerium villosum. Thus, this study investigates the extract from this plant, which belongs to the Fabaceae family, known for its rich flavonoid content.
